The Center Part : Timeless Elegance and Symmetry

The center part is a classic and timeless hair parting technique that exudes elegance and symmetry. It works well with various hair lengths and textures, providing a balanced and harmonious look. The center part is versatile and can be adapted to different hairstyles, from sleek and straight to soft waves or voluminous curls. It frames the face beautifully and adds a touch of sophistication to any ensemble.

The Side Part: Effortless Chic and Versatility

The side part is a versatile technique that allows you to play with your hair’s natural movement and create different looks. It can be placed deep or shallow, depending on your desired effect. A deep side part adds drama and volume, while a shallow side part provides a more subtle and laid-back vibe. The side part is ideal for creating asymmetry and adding interest to hairstyles such as ponytails, updos, or loose waves.

The Zigzag Part: Playful and Modern

For those seeking a unique and playful look, the zigzag part is an excellent option. This technique involves creating a series of diagonal part lines, adding a touch of modernity and edginess to your hairstyle. The zigzag part is particularly effective for adding volume and dimension to straight or fine hair. It can also be combined with other styling techniques, such as braids or updos, to create visually striking and dynamic hairstyles.

The Deep Side Part: Glamorous and Alluring

A deep side part instantly adds glamour and allure to any hairstyle. By parting your hair significantly off-center, you create a striking asymmetrical look that draws attention to your features. The deep side part is ideal for creating voluminous styles with cascading curls or waves. It works particularly well for formal occasions or when you want to make a statement with your hairstyle.

The Middle Part with a Twist: Bohemian and Relaxed

For a bohemian and relaxed vibe, consider adding a twist to your middle part. Instead of a straight and precise part, create a slightly tousled or imperfect middle part. This technique adds a carefree and effortlessly chic touch to your hairstyle. It complements loose, beachy waves or tousled updos, giving you that effortlessly cool, “I woke up like this” aesthetic.
